Proven Size Reduction Technology
The hammer mill is a key component for substrate preparation. By reducing the size of the input material, its surface area is increased, allowing bacteria to process the nutrients faster and more efficiently. This results in a higher gas yield and a shorter residence time in the fermenter.
Operating Principle
Size reduction is achieved by swinging hammers mounted on two adjacent rotor shafts. These rotate in opposite directions at up to 3,000 revolutions per minute. The resulting centrifugal forces and the flinging of material between the rotors ensure effective size reduction to the desired particle size.

Technical Data
| Number of hammers: | 30 to 40 per rotor shaft |
| Rotor drive: | Coupling |
| Connected load rotor 1: | 22 / 30 kW |
| Connected load rotor 2: | 18.5 / 22 kW |
| Throughput: | 4 bis 16 t/h* |
*depending on substrate and unit size
